Mount Cawte
Mount Cawte is a peak in Marlborough District, Marlborough and has an elevation of 76 metres. Mount Cawte is situated nearby to the hamlet Moenui, as well as near Moetapu Bay.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Moenui
Hamlet
Moenui is a small settlement 3 km east of Havelock in the South Island of New Zealand. It is situated on the shores of the Mahikipawa arm of the Mahau Sound - one of the many sounds in the Marlborough Sounds. The meaning of Moenui is "Big Sleep".
